infoRouter Document Management Software V8.0 - Knowledge Base Article 130 |
| 130 |
| Tag Definitions file not found. |
| SYMPTOMS |
|
infoRouter keeps predefined tag names in a file called "tagdefs.xml" which is located in "[inforouter application path]\config" directory. This exception has occurs when the "Network Services" account or "Impersinated User account" do not have the read permission to the config path or spesificly to this file. This exception has occurs when this file is missing or corrupted.. |
| RESOLUTION |
|
Generally this happens right after a server migration. Please make sure you copied all the files while migrating inforouter application. Make sure "Network Services" account or "Impersonated User account" has "full control" permission on the config path and all files underneath. If you think you accidenlty deleted the file you might run live update program that restores required files from the inforouter support site. |
